Strength training relies on two fundamental principles: progressive overload and proper form. Progressive overload refers to gradually increasing the demands placed on your muscles over time. This can be achieved by increasing the weight, repetitions, or sets of your exercises, or by incorporating more challenging variations. Proper form, however, is paramount to prevent injuries and maximize results. Maintaining correct posture and movement patterns ensures that the targeted muscles are effectively engaged, while simultaneously minimizing the risk of strains, sprains, or other musculoskeletal problems. Ignoring proper form can negate the benefits of strength training and lead to setbacks.
Essential Equipment for Basic Strength Training
A basic strength training program can be effectively implemented with minimal equipment, whether at home or in a gym. The key is to select tools that allow you to perform a variety of compound exercises targeting multiple muscle groups simultaneously. This approach maximizes efficiency and overall strength gains.
- Dumbbells: Adjustable dumbbells are ideal for home workouts, offering versatility and space-saving convenience. They allow for a wide range of exercises, including bicep curls, shoulder presses, and squats.
- Barbell: A barbell, typically found in gyms, provides a more substantial weight load for exercises like squats, deadlifts, and bench presses. Proper form is crucial when using a barbell due to the heavier weights involved.
- Resistance Bands: These portable and affordable bands offer variable resistance levels, making them suitable for both beginners and advanced individuals. They can be used for a wide variety of exercises, adding resistance to bodyweight movements.
- Weight Bench: A weight bench provides support and stability for exercises like bench presses, dumbbell rows, and incline presses. An adjustable bench enhances versatility.
- Pull-up Bar: A pull-up bar, easily installed at home, allows for effective upper body exercises, strengthening back and arm muscles. Variations in grip can target different muscle groups.

Three-Day Beginner Strength Training Program
This program focuses on compound movements that work multiple muscle groups simultaneously, promoting overall strength development. It’s designed to be performed three times a week, with rest days in between to allow for muscle recovery. Remember to listen to your body and adjust the program as needed.
Day | Focus | Exercises | Sets | Reps | Rest |
---|---|---|---|---|---|
Monday | Upper Body | Push-ups (or incline push-ups), Dumbbell Rows, Overhead Press (using dumbbells or resistance bands), Bicep Curls (using dumbbells or resistance bands), Triceps Extensions (using dumbbells or resistance bands) | 3 | 8-12 | 60-90 seconds |
Wednesday | Lower Body & Core | Squats (bodyweight or goblet squats with a dumbbell), Lunges (alternating legs), Glute Bridges, Plank, Crunches | 3 | 8-12 | 60-90 seconds |
Friday | Full Body | Deadlifts (using light weight or resistance bands), Push-ups, Bent-over Rows (using dumbbells or resistance bands), Walking Lunges, Bird-dog (core exercise) | 3 | 8-12 | 60-90 seconds |
Warm-up Routine
A proper warm-up prepares your body for exercise, increasing blood flow to muscles and reducing the risk of injury. A dynamic warm-up, involving movement, is recommended before each workout.
- Light cardio, such as jogging in place or jumping jacks (5 minutes)
- Dynamic stretches, such as arm circles, leg swings, and torso twists (5 minutes)
Cool-down Routine
A cool-down helps your body gradually return to a resting state, reducing muscle soreness and promoting recovery. Static stretches, holding a stretch for 20-30 seconds, are ideal for a cool-down.
- Static stretches targeting the muscles worked during the workout (10 minutes). Examples include hamstring stretches, quad stretches, chest stretches, triceps stretches, and shoulder stretches.

Common Mistakes During Basic Strength Exercises
Improper form is a significant contributor to strength training injuries. Failing to maintain a neutral spine during exercises like squats and deadlifts can strain the lower back. Using momentum instead of controlled movements leads to instability and increases the risk of muscle tears or joint injuries. Additionally, neglecting a proper warm-up increases the likelihood of muscle pulls or strains. Finally, lifting weights that are too heavy for one’s current strength level is a common cause of injury.
- Rounded Back During Squats and Deadlifts: This puts excessive stress on the spine, potentially leading to herniated discs or back pain. The correction involves focusing on maintaining a neutral spine throughout the movement, engaging the core muscles, and potentially reducing the weight used.
- Using Momentum Instead of Controlled Movements: Jerky movements increase the risk of injury. The solution is to perform each repetition slowly and deliberately, focusing on controlled concentric (lifting) and eccentric (lowering) phases.
- Insufficient Warm-up: Failing to adequately prepare the muscles and joints increases the risk of strains and tears. A proper warm-up should include dynamic stretching and light cardio to increase blood flow and muscle temperature.
- Lifting Weights That Are Too Heavy: Attempting to lift beyond one’s capacity greatly increases the chance of injury. Begin with lighter weights and focus on perfecting form before gradually increasing the load.

Importance of Proper Breathing Techniques
Breathing plays a vital role in strength training. Holding your breath during exertion can increase blood pressure and put unnecessary strain on the cardiovascular system. Proper breathing helps stabilize the core, improves lifting performance, and reduces the risk of injury. A common technique involves exhaling during the concentric phase (lifting) and inhaling during the eccentric phase (lowering).
Proper breathing helps maintain core stability, improves lifting performance, and reduces the risk of injury.

Modified Exercises for Different Fitness Levels
Modifying exercises allows individuals of varying fitness levels to participate safely and effectively in strength training. Beginners need simpler movements to build a foundation, while intermediate and advanced trainees require more challenging variations to stimulate continued growth. The focus should always be on maintaining proper form to minimize injury risk.
Here are examples of modified exercises for different levels:
Exercise | Beginner | Intermediate | Advanced |
---|---|---|---|
Squat | Bodyweight squats, assisted by holding onto a chair or wall | Goblet squats (holding a dumbbell or kettlebell close to the chest) | Barbell back squats with added weight |
Push-up | Wall push-ups or incline push-ups (hands on an elevated surface) | Standard push-ups on the floor | Decline push-ups (feet elevated), plyometric push-ups |
Row | Incline dumbbell rows (using a bench for support) | Dumbbell rows (using a bench for support, but less incline) | Barbell rows, using heavier weight |
Scaling Exercises Based on Individual Strength
Scaling exercises involves adjusting the intensity or difficulty to match an individual’s current strength capabilities. This can involve changing the weight used, the number of repetitions performed, the range of motion, or the type of exercise itself. Careful monitoring of one’s progress and adjusting the workout accordingly is crucial for safety and effectiveness.
Here are some tips for scaling exercises:
- Start with a weight that allows you to complete the desired number of repetitions with good form. If you can’t maintain proper form, reduce the weight.
- Increase the weight gradually as you get stronger. A general guideline is to increase the weight by 2.5-5% when you can easily complete all repetitions with good form.
- Focus on progressive overload. This means consistently challenging your muscles by gradually increasing the weight, repetitions, or sets over time.
- Consider using different rep ranges to target different training goals. Higher reps (12-15+) focus on muscular endurance, while lower reps (1-5) emphasize maximal strength.
Bodyweight Training Versus Weight Training
Both bodyweight training and weight training are effective methods for building strength, but they offer different advantages and disadvantages. Bodyweight training is accessible, requiring no equipment, making it ideal for beginners or those with limited resources. Weight training, however, allows for more precise control over resistance and progressive overload, leading to greater strength gains in the long term for most individuals.
Here’s a comparison:
Feature | Bodyweight Training | Weight Training |
---|---|---|
Accessibility | High (requires no equipment) | Moderate (requires equipment) |
Progressive Overload | More challenging to achieve consistently | Easier to achieve through weight adjustments |
Muscle Growth | Can stimulate muscle growth, but often requires advanced variations | Generally more effective for significant muscle growth |
Specificity | Less specific muscle targeting | Allows for more targeted muscle work |
